External PID is a mechanism present on BookE 2.06 that enables application to store/load data from different address spaces. There are special version of some instructions, which operate on alternate address space, which is specified in the EPLC/EPSC regiser. This implementation uses two additional MMU modes (mmu_idx) to provide the address space for the load and store instructions. The QEMU TLB fill code was modified to recognize these MMU modes and use the values in EPLC/EPSC to find the proper entry in he PPC TLB. These two QEMU TLBs are also flushed on each write to EPLC/EPSC. Following instructions are implemented: dcbfep dcbstep dcbtep dcbtstep dcbzep dcbzlep icbiep lbepx ldepx lfdepx lhepx lwepx stbepx stdepx stfdepx sthepx stwepx.
